
A Luna for The Cursed Alpha
For years, Lyra was the prophecy.
She had the red hair, the green eyes, and the singular destiny: to become Luna and bring unrivaled power to the Incarnadine Pack. She dedicated her life to Alpha Rhys, trading her orphan past for a powerful future.
But on the day of their engagement, Rhys shattered her world with a single, cruel declaration. He presented a perfect, prettier copy of Lyra —and publicly rejected his rightful Luna.
Cast out, ridiculed, and targeted for death by the very pack she was meant to rule, Lyra ’s only path to survival was the most reckless gamble in the Land of Verdentia: she submitted her name for the Alpha King’s Luna Selection.
The prize is a crown. The cost is suicide.
King Kian is dark, cold, and rumored to be cursed. Every she-wolf fears his name, yet Lyra is determined to earn his terrifying affection. She must. His power is the only shield strong enough to stop her former pack from tearing her apart.
But just as Lyra begins to melt the ice around the King’s heart, a desperate Rhys realizes the devastating secret he threw away and comes crawling back, determined to reclaim his Luna. He discovers, however, that the Cursed King is fiercely territorial.
“Lay a hand on my Luna,” Kian snarls, his voice a promise of utter destruction, “and I’ll destroy you and your entire pack.”
Lyra survived one betrayal. Can she survive a King’s obsession, and a former Alpha’s desperate regret, without losing her soul entirely?
